Went to PF in lapa with a printout from the website and the information was correct according to the website. However it was sent to the delegacia in Bahia.

So i asked what it was doing there and she said she doesnt know why but Brasilia is sending the cards out to Bahia. Im sure not all of them are being sent there but enough to make me believe that im not the only one who has there card waiting for pickup in a completely different estado.

She asked me if i would like to pick it up from there, so i laughed. Then she made a request for it to be sent to SP and said i should come back in another 2 months.

Just a tip :

I check the website today and my status changed from "Sent to DPF" to "Disponível para entrega". I think this time is the good one :)

So wait for having status "Disponivel para entrega" and not only "Sent to DPF" (even if it has been sent more than one month ago, it doesn't mean that the card arrived / or is ready for delivery, don't ask me how this is possible ...)
